This is a randomized, parallel, single-blinded multi-center study. The objective is to compare the long term clinical outcomes among the site of atrial pacing and to compare the long term effect of the atrial fibrillation (AF) Suppression algorithm.

Pacemaker implantation with RA lead placed in low atrial septal position
Other names: Identity ADx DR device
Pacemaker implantation with RA lead placed in right atrial appendage position
Other names: Identity ADx DR pacemaker
